What is ELO-P Funding?

In 2022, California announced historic funding for the Expanding Learning Opportunity Programs (ELO-P); a $4 billion investment in summer and after-school learning programs. ELO-P mandates that public school districts and charter schools provide their most vulnerable students with enriching, 9-hour per day programs for 180 school days and 30 "intersession" days during school breaks or summer. Programs can be offered to all students, but they must provide access to high-priority students first.

Thanks to this funding and other donations, almost 80% of campers attended EDMO completely free last summer. The state of California has become a huge catalyst for equity in the out-of-school time space, making our choice to shift our focus clear and necessary.

ELO-P's IMPACT

81%

children assisted with schoolwork

81% reported that EDMO helped their child get their homework done on time.

83%

reported that EDMO made their child more excited to go to school

Excited and better prepared kids mean better attendance rates, shown by numerous studies.

99%

parents/guardians assisted with child care

99% of parents/guardians in EDMO programs relied on EDMO so that they could go to work or school. When parents work, and their child care is free, they have more resources for other necessities such as housing and food.

10,000

Kids engaged Annually

Thanks to ELO-P funding, we are a nonprofit that engages roughly 10,000 students annually, up from approximately 2,000 kids we worked with pre-pandemic.

200+

School Partners

We partner with 17 school districts and charter schools, across 13 counties in Northern and Central CA.
